Match Report: St Mirren 1-1 Hamilton Academical

Ilkay Durmus' 73rd minute free-kick salvaged a point for St Mirren as the Buddies drew their third Ladbrokes Premiership match in a row.

Saints found themselves behind to a 25th minute David Templeton strike in a lacklustre first-half showing for Jim Goodwin's side.

But a better second-half performance saw Saints grab a point with Durmus curling home from 20 yards after Ryan Flynn had been fouled.

By the manager's own admission the Buddies were not at the races in the first 45 minutes and Hamilton capitalised with 25 minutes on the clock. A long ball forward from Accies captain Brian Easton found Mickel Miller who beat Calum Waters to head the ball into the path of Templeton who slammed home from 25 yards out to give the visitors the lead. 

It was a controversial opener given Accies goalkeeper Luke Southwood had clearly handled outside his box just 20 seconds earlier while Waters was on the ground with a head knock after clashing with Miller.

Saints tried to bounce back in a positive fashion with Durmus heading wide from a decent area inside the box after meeting Morias' cross.

But two minutes later Templeton was just inches away from adding his and Accies' second when he flashed just wide from 20 yards.

And with seven minutes remaining of the half, Vaclav Hladky kept the scoreline down as the game ebbed towards half-time when he got the slightest touch on Marios Ogkmpoe's ferocious effort from 25 yards to touch it on to the bar.

The Czech goalkeeper also managed to gather on the line after a scramble inside the Saints penalty area following a Hamilton corner on 43 minutes.

In truth Saints were lucky to only be 1-0 down at the break, but started the second-half the brighter of the two sides. Lee Hodson, who replaced Jamie McGrath at half-time, played a low ball across the face of the box with less than two minutes of the second-half played where it met Cammy MacPherson. But the Saints midfielder scooped the ball over from 15 yards.

Tony Andreu was presented with a wonderful opportunity as the ball fell to him inside the box on 68 minutes but the Hamilton defence did well to block and deflect narrowly over. 

With just over 15 mintues remaining Saints would find themselves level. A really poor challenge from Mickel Miller on Ryan Flynn saw Saints awarded a free-kick right on the edge of the area. After a delay which saw Flynn receive treatment before being substituted, Durmus stepped up to confidently curl home into the top corner to equalise. 

St Mirren would have hoped to kick on in the final stretch of the match to try and find a winner but were dealt a major blow just two minutes later when Hamilton were awarded a penalty kick. Hodson's flailing leg brought down the forward who had nipped in just ahead of the Northern Ireland international. It was Miller who grabbed the ball to take the spot-kick, but despite Hladky diving the wrong way, the striker sent his effort wide from 12 yards. 

Saints were denied their own penalty in stoppage time when substitute Alex Jakubiak appeared to be hauled down in the box, but referee Alan Newlands was unmoved. 

Full-Time: St Mirren 1-1 Hamilton
